Hutuobi Military Tunnels (虎跳牆軍事坑道)

A sprawling complex of tunnels and fortifications constructed beneath what is now Yilan County No. 1 Public Cemetery (員山鄉第一公墓) in Yuanshan, Yilan County, by the Imperial Japanese Army in 1943. Although it was never completed and did not see any action in the war, it was intended for use in the defense of Yilan, particularly in the event of an Allied landing.

There are several facilities and different access points scattered throughout the eastern part of the cemetery. Exercise caution when exploring the tunnels; they are very extensive, easily reaching several kilometers in length, and not always safe to enter. Beware bats and other hazards!
